The collection features seminal works by David Morley and Charlotte Brunsdon that explore the impact of television on everyday life and audience engagement. Their analyses provide a critical examination of the cultural significance of the television program "Nationwide," offering insights into media consumption and its effects on viewers. This compilation serves as a valuable resource for understanding the evolution of television studies and audience research.
